A common origin for immunity and digestion

Front Immunol. 2015 Feb 19:6:72. doi: 10.3389/fimmu.2015.00072. eCollection 2015.

Abstract

Historically, the digestive and immune systems were viewed and studied as separate entities. However, there are remarkable similarities and shared functions in both nutrient acquisition and host defense. Here, I propose a common origin for both systems. This association provides a new prism for viewing the emergence and evolution of host defense mechanisms.
